India–UAE flights: Air India, IndiGo, Air India Express extend suspension

## Flight Suspensions Continue

Airlines operating between India and the UAE have extended flight suspensions due to ongoing tensions in the Middle East. Air India, IndiGo, and Air India Express are among the carriers affected, with disruptions expected to continue as the situation evolves.

## Passenger Options

Air India is offering flexibility for passengers with bookings made on or before February 28, allowing them to reschedule or cancel for a full refund if their travel plans are impacted. Air India Express has also extended its suspension of flights to several Gulf countries until March 2, offering similar options to affected travelers.

## IndiGo and Other Airlines

IndiGo is taking a cautious approach, providing passengers with options to explore alternative travel arrangements or claim refunds. Meanwhile, Akasa Air and Spice Jet have also suspended flights to various Middle Eastern destinations, with Akasa Air's suspension lasting until March 2 and Spice Jet's until March 1.

## Ongoing Monitoring

Airlines are closely monitoring the situation, prioritizing the safety of passengers and crew. Travelers are advised to stay updated through official channels and check their flight status before heading to the airport.
